Assessment way of collecting and evaluating data for measurements purpoes
Career day an event that allows you to talk with many businesses at one time
Career fair an orginzed time that allows you to listen to and interact with people in careers that interest you.
Formal assessment written by psychologists and career counselors who research careers skills to create the test
Informal assessment activites in which you talk to someone working in a career or obsere someone working in a career
Interest inventors surveys designed to help you relate your interest to career cluster
Internal Career Design unique to you, matching your interests, abilities, personnlity and work values to an idel career field for you.
Job shadowing spend sevral hours observing a worker at his or her workplace
Informational interview Talking to people about careers to gathere facts and gain an understanding about a career area you are considering.

Self-assessment the results of these test are based on what you think of yourself
Self awareness knowing yourself at the present time
Service learning an educational method that combines classroom education with community service to address real-world needs.
Skills assessment how well you perform specific task now and whether you can master certain skills in the future
Work values aspects about a career and the workplace are important to you.
